Abstract

The recognition of splicing sites is an important step in gene recognition. We introduce a synthesis method for splicing sites prediction based on short sequence pattern and long sequence pattern. There are some weights in short sequence pattern and long sequence pattern. We regulate weights by simulated anneal. Applying the method to recognize both the true and false splicing sites, the result shows true positive rate and false positive rate and compared with GeneSplicer.
